<span>The Chinese Exclusion Act of 1882 was introduced during a time of high volume immigration by Chinese-Americans. This act was a response to the higher levels of immigrants migrating to the United States. This was also a racist response, put into place after a law banning naturalization of non-white Americans.</span>

Octavia E. Butler's "The Book of Martha" is a story about a woman named Martha and her desire and plan to help create a perfect world. And in the process, she learned to navigate life as it is, accepting the good and the bad that the world contains.
In the given excerpt, Martha questions God about why He let some live while others are 'fated' to die. This passage shows the moral dilemma of how some people are tasked with decisions that only place more burdens on them.
